In the wake of The Ashley Madison Affair, a documentary available for streaming on Hulu, a lot of people who may have forgotten or never heard about the dating platform are taking an interest. The dating site launched in 2001 with the goal of helping to destigmatize extramarital relationships. The name of the platform comes from two randomly-selected popular baby names from the year the company launched.

The Short Version: Replika is an AI chatbot released in 2017. The AI learns about each user, changing the way they chat to not only better suit the needs of the user but also to better replicate the user themselves. The team behind Replika recently released Blush, a new AI geared toward dating and relationships. The Short Version: WeAreX is a newly released dating app inclusive of those in alternative relationships. The app combines aspects of dating and social media apps to create a hybrid platform centered around community. Users will find the standard swiping and matchmaking tools along with blogs, expert-led workshops, and event listings. Anonymous dating took a big hit when Craigslist personals disappeared from the internet in 2018. Fortunately, Doublelist rose to the challenge as a Craigslist alternative in the same year. The personals site offers the same no-names-needed experience paired with enhanced security features to keep it from being shut down.
